Output 616046a135a6065823545293d084a5113a7f294414cf77f49c72b39de66758e3:155

value
734059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94dc0de129fcaf3c9bf277244bc0a5a46c776079 OP_EQUAL
address
3FG7YZziNyNbBXmGZtD4LrLF5ScwwHhyst
transaction
616046a135a6065823545293d084a5113a7f294414cf77f49c72b39de66758e3
confirmations
123233
spent
true